Customer Review: Cat door may be too big if you have small dogs. Summary: 5 Stars
I bought this gate to keep my dogs upstairs. I chose this particular gate because it seemed tall enough that my Labrador wouldn't be able to jump it and it also has a door that allows the cats to come and go since their litter and food are upstairs but they like to spend their days downstairs. The installation was very simple after I read the instructions, and opening and closing the gate is easy. The only problem is the opening for the cat it too big, it's around 7" by 10". The size allows my Norwich Terrier to walk through also. I've solved this problem by keeping the cat door closed and cutting off one of the bars in the door providing an opening just big enough for the cats but too small for the dog. Another buyer noted that their cat got stuck in the bars, my oldest cat also got stuck trying to go through the bars on the sides but I used some treats to lure her through the door and I've had no problems since, so training your cat may be necessary. Also if you are installing this gate at the top of a staircase be sure to line it up with the very edge of the top stair if possible, the banister is in the way for me to do this, but seeing as the gate has a bottom edge that you have to step over it would be safer. Overall I am very happy with this gate and would recommend it just think about the cat door if you also have small dogs.

Customer Review: Dog/cat gate Summary: 5 Stars
I purchased this gate because we needed to create a space that our dogs can't get into our cats' "stuff". The first thing I figured out was that you don't need to drill the "holder things" into the wall. It is a tension gate so the more tension you put on it the more it all pushes together, so if you are unable to open the door to the gate (or close it)..release some tension (or add some). The cat door is a good size, we have two cats, one is rather large (not fat but tall and long) and he is able to get in and out of it easily. Neither cat is afraid of it either which is a plus. With that said my smaller dog can get through it, which we figured would happen before we bought it (12lb mutt-the large cat is bigger then him), but we are working on training him not to. Other people reviewed that their larger dog was able to get through the cat opening, and one dog was even able to climb over the gate, I can only say that a determined dog will do whatever they have to do to get what they want. Overall I am very happy with it. The locking mechanism is easy to use and it is very sturdy.
